Women Clothes in Winter

Creating the perfect winter capsule wardrobe is all about refinement not excess. When the temperature drops, an elegant woman turns to timeless, versatile pieces that feel luxurious and look effortlessly pulled together. From tailored wool coats to soft cashmere knits, these twelve key items form the foundation of a sophisticated cold-weather wardrobe that will see you through every occasion.

1. Camel Coat

A camel coat is the ultimate winter classic and the hero piece every woman needs. It instantly adds polish to jeans, dresses, or tailored trousers. For timeless options, explore Reiss, COS, or Max Mara for investment-worthy styles that never date.

2. Cashmere Jumper

Nothing says winter elegance quite like a cashmere jumper. Choose neutral tones like cream, oatmeal, or grey they go with everything. Arket, Marks & Spencer Autograph, and Reformation offer quality knits that look and feel luxurious.

3. Tailored Blazer

A structured blazer adds instant sophistication to any outfit. Wear it layered over a knit or with jeans for a relaxed yet refined look. The Holland Cooper Knightsbridge blazer or a Massimo Dutti wool blend version are both perfect choices for quiet-luxury styling.

4. Wool Trousers

Wool trousers are an elegant alternative to denim for winter. Choose a wide-leg or straight-leg style that flatters and elongates your frame. Look to Reiss, COS, or Uniqlo for elevated tailoring that works from office to evening.

5. Silk Blouse

A silk blouse is a year-round essential that adds femininity to any winter outfit. Layer it under a blazer or tuck into high-waisted trousers for a polished finish. Discover timeless designs at Sezane, Ralph Lauren or Me+Em.

6. Straight-Leg Jeans

For casual days, straight-leg jeans are the most versatile and flattering style. Choose dark indigo or mid-wash denim for a more elevated, quiet-luxury feel. Brands like Agolde, Levi’s, and Mango offer chic, everyday options.

7. Knitted Dress

A knitted midi dress is an effortless winter staple. It’s cosy, versatile, and easily dressed up or down. Add a belt and knee-high boots for a flattering silhouette. Browse Reformation, Nobody’s Child or H&M for beautiful options.

8. Knee-High Boots

Knee-high boots add structure and sophistication to every look. Choose smooth leather or suede in neutral tones like tan or chocolate. The Marks and Spencer, Ralph Lauren or Mint Velvet are enduring winter favourites.

9. Loafers

For smart-casual days, loafers are the definition of understated elegance. They work perfectly with jeans, dresses, and tailored trousers alike. Try Ralph Lauren, Aeyde, or Russell & Bromley for timeless loafers that elevate any outfit.

10. Statement Coat

A second coat in navy, charcoal, or black adds versatility and depth to your capsule wardrobe. Opt for tailored wool or textured boucle styles from Chloé, Holland Cooper or Reformation to achieve that sophisticated city look.

12. Cashmere Scarf

Finish your winter capsule with a soft, neutral cashmere scarf a small detail that makes every outfit look more refined. Mango, Marks & Spencer and The White Company offer timeless options that will last for years.
